Reginald Bolding is a former American politician. He was a member of the Democratic Party. He served in the Arizona House of Representatives for District 27. He was a representative from 2015 to 2023.

Serving as Minority Leader
From 2021 to 2023, Reginald Bolding was the Minority Leader. In a government, the "minority party" is the one with fewer members. The Minority Leader helps guide their party's actions. They also speak for their party's ideas.
Reginald Bolding's Background and Education
Reginald Bolding studied at the University of Cincinnati. He earned a degree in Criminal Justice and International Security. This education helped him understand laws and safety.
Recognitions and Leadership Roles
Bolding was recognized for his work. The Phoenix Business Journal included him on their "40 under 40" list. This list highlights successful young professionals.
He also held important leadership positions:
- He was a ranking member of the Arizona House Education Committee. This committee focuses on school-related laws.
- He served on the Ways & Means Committee. This committee deals with money and taxes.
- He was the vice chair for the Western Region of the National Black Caucus of State Legislators.
- He led the Arizona Black Legislative Caucus.
- He started the Arizona Coalition for Change. This group helps people get involved in their community.
Reginald Bolding's Elections
Reginald Bolding was elected to the Arizona House of Representatives multiple times.
2014 Election Details
In 2014, Bolding ran for the first time. He won against several other candidates in the Democratic primary election. A primary election helps a party choose its best candidate. Later, in the general election, he won against Myron L. Jackson. Bolding received 13,950 votes.
2016 Reelection
In 2016, Reginald Bolding ran for reelection. He was successful and continued to serve his district.
2022 Secretary of State Campaign
In 2022, Bolding ran for a different state office. He wanted to become the Secretary of State of Arizona. This role often involves overseeing elections. He ran in the Democratic primary but did not win. Adrian Fontes won that primary election.
